CfnEndpointAuthorizationPropsMixin

class aws_cdk.mixins_preview.aws_redshift.mixins.CfnEndpointAuthorizationPropsMixin(props, *, strategy=None)

Bases: Mixin

Describes an endpoint authorization for authorizing Redshift-managed VPC endpoint access to a cluster across AWS accounts .

See:

http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-resource-redshift-endpointauthorization.html

CloudformationResource:

AWS::Redshift::EndpointAuthorization

Mixin:

true

ExampleMetadata:

fixture=_generated

Example:

# The code below shows an example of how to instantiate this type.
# The values are placeholders you should change.
from aws_cdk.mixins_preview import mixins
from aws_cdk.mixins_preview.aws_redshift import mixins as redshift_mixins

cfn_endpoint_authorization_props_mixin = redshift_mixins.CfnEndpointAuthorizationPropsMixin(redshift_mixins.CfnEndpointAuthorizationMixinProps(
    account="account",
    cluster_identifier="clusterIdentifier",
    force=False,
    vpc_ids=["vpcIds"]
),
    strategy=mixins.PropertyMergeStrategy.OVERRIDE
)

Create a mixin to apply properties to AWS::Redshift::EndpointAuthorization.
